数据库过大如何上传服务器
-
要将大型数据库上传到服务器,可以按照以下步骤进行操作:
- 压缩数据库文件:使用压缩工具如WinRAR或7-Zip,将数据库文件进行压缩,以减小文件大小。这可以极大地节省上传时间和带宽消耗。
- 使用FTP上传:使用FTP(文件传输协议)客户端软件,通过FTP连接将压缩后的数据库文件上传到服务器。在FTP客户端中,输入服务器地址、用户名、密码,选择要上传的文件,然后开始上传。
- 分割文件上传:如果数据库文件仍然过大,可以将其分割成较小的部分,然后逐个上传。这样可以避免上传过程中出现错误或中断,同时也有利于管理和备份数据库文件。
- 使用云存储服务:考虑使用云存储服务如Google Drive、Dropbox或OneDrive等,这些服务提供了大容量的云端存储空间,可以方便地上传和共享文件。将数据库文件上传到云存储服务,然后将共享链接发送给服务器管理员即可。
- 使用数据库备份与恢复工具:大部分数据库管理系统都提供了备份与恢复工具,可以使用这些工具将数据库文件备份为较小的文件,然后将备份文件上传到服务器。在服务器端,使用相应的恢复工具将备份文件导入到数据库系统中。
需要注意的是,在上传大型数据库文件时,可能会面临上传时间过长和带宽限制的问题。为了提高上传效率,可以考虑在非高峰期进行上传,或者与服务器管理员联系,寻求其他解决方案,如通过外部存储设备或物理介质直接传输数据库文件。另外,在上传完成后,务必进行数据完整性检查和数据库恢复测试,确保上传的文件正确无误。
1年前 -
在上传数据库过大的情况下,可以采取以下几种方法来解决问题:
-
压缩数据库文件:首先,将数据库文件进行压缩,以减少文件的大小。您可以使用压缩工具(如zip或gzip)来压缩数据库文件。压缩后的文件可以更快地上传到服务器。
-
分割数据库文件:如果数据库文件过大,可以考虑将其分割成多个较小的文件。通过将数据库表分为多个文件或将数据库文件分为多个部分,可以简化上传过程。在服务器上重新组合文件后,可以重新创建完整的数据库。
-
使用数据库导出和导入工具:大多数数据库管理系统都提供了导出和导入工具,可以方便地将数据库从一个系统导出到另一个系统。您可以使用这些工具将数据库导出为一个或多个文件,并在服务器上使用相同的工具将数据库导入。
-
使用数据库备份和还原工具:数据库备份和还原工具可以将完整的数据库备份为一个文件,并在服务器上还原为完整的数据库。这是一种快速和方便的方法,适用于将整个数据库迁移到服务器上。
-
利用网络传输工具:如果数据库文件过大以至于无法通过常规的网络上传,可以使用专门的网络传输工具来上传文件。这些工具通常分割文件并使用多个网络连接来加快传输速度。您可以将文件分割为多个块,然后使用这些工具将块逐个上传到服务器。
无论使用哪种方法,上传数据库前应确保有足够的存储空间和网络带宽来支持文件传输。此外,还应根据服务器系统和数据库管理系统的要求对文件进行适当的处理和配置。
1年前 -
-
数据库过大时,上传到服务器可能会遇到文件大小限制、网络传输速度、服务器存储空间等问题。下面是一种解决方案:
-
压缩数据库文件:可以使用数据库管理工具(如MySQL的mysqldump命令)将数据库导出为sql文件,并使用压缩工具(如WinRAR)将导出的sql文件压缩成zip或rar格式,以减小文件大小。
-
分割数据库文件:如果数据库文件过大,可以将其切割成多个较小的文件。可以使用数据库管理工具的导出命令或脚本语句将数据库中的不同表或数据段导出为不同的文件。
-
使用文件传输工具:可以使用FTP(文件传输协议)或SFTP(安全文件传输协议)等工具将压缩或分割后的数据库文件上传至服务器。这些工具在传输大文件时往往比HTTP(超文本传输协议)更快速稳定。
-
从服务器端解压或合并文件:将数据库文件传输至服务器后,需要在服务器上进行解压或合并操作。可以使用解压工具(如WinRAR)解压压缩文件,或使用数据库管理工具的导入命令或脚本语句将分割的文件合并为一个完整的数据库文件。
-
验证数据完整性:上传完成后,需要进行数据完整性验证。可以使用数据库管理工具连接至服务器,检查导入的数据是否与本地数据库一致,并进行必要的修复。
注意事项:
- 在上传数据库文件之前,最好先备份一份本地数据库,以防上传过程中出现意外导致数据丢失。
- 在进行文件传输时,尽量选择空闲时段,以避免对网络带宽造成干扰。
- 上传大型数据库文件可能需要较长时间,确保服务器的连接稳定并且不会中断。
总结:
通过压缩、分割、上传和解压文件的方式,可以将大型数据库文件成功地上传到服务器。关键是确保上传过程的稳定性和数据的完整性。1年前 -